Camel Pose (Ustrasana): Camel pose is a heart-opening posture that stretches the chest, lungs, and abdomen. To perform this pose, kneel on the floor with your knees hip-width apart. Then, place your hands on your lower back, and slowly lean back while keeping your hips aligned over your knees. Reach your hands down to your heels and push your hips forward, allowing your heart to open. Hold this pose for 30 seconds to one minute before returning to the starting position.
